Superbowl 2012

The spectacle that is the Superbowl is done and dusted for another year. I caught portions of it and intend on watching in full later tonight.
If there is an event to be held and done to the extreme of all avenues of the term entertainment, then the Americans achieve it with the Superbowl.
The Sunday night prime time, multi-million dollar ads and the half time show define the big event. It's possibly the only ads people look forward too. If you search in google for Superbowl, it will suggest Superbowl ads. That shows you just how powerful this event has become.
The half time show is long enough to allow for a stage to be put out in the centre for a huge light, song and dance show. Meanwhile the players could just about head out for lunch they have so much time to waste.
In Australia we simply cannot match their showcase as we play our grand final during the day, robbing us of fireworks and light shows. And we also lack a lengthy half time, so generally there is just enough time for a little league game.
Next to Olympic opening ceremonies, there is no bigger show centered around a sporting event and keep in mind the Superbowl is one game and not a series of different events over several weeks.
